[Softball] Tigers sweep Knights
Georgetown College softball finished off the sweep of Mid-South Conference newcomer and independent member Kentucky Christian University on Saturday.
The Tigers (28-13, 14-8) tallied a 7-1 win behind the leadership of the three seniors and junior pitcher Hannah Morton. They all gutted out a four-hit, two run win, 2-1, in game two.
Morton went 3-for-3 from the plate in game one and in the circle went five innings, allowing three hits and striking out three. Megan Brankamp finished off the day, going two innings with four hits and a run.
